AP - Louisiana Gov. Bobby Jindal declared a state of emergency Sunday as the Gulf Coast braced for the arrival of Hurricane Ida, which was making its way across the Gulf of Mexico as a Category 2 storm.

    AP - Three days of heavy rains in El Salvador touched off floods and slides that have killed at least 91 people, the government said Sunday.

    AFP - Hurricane Ida is now a category two storm packing top wind speeds of nearly 100 miles (160 kilometers) per hour as it heads towards Mexico's Yucatan Peninsula, the Miami-based National Hurricane Center said.
